Technical overview of the browser-native terrain simulation pipeline.
HTML5 Canvas API with requestAnimationFrame loop delivers smooth 60 FPS terrain rendering without any external graphic libraries or asset dependencies.
All terrain entities and gem positions are procedurally generated using mathematical algorithms, ensuring unique expedition layouts on every simulation run.
Supports keyboard, touch, and pointer input simultaneously, enabling seamless rover control across desktop browsers and mobile devices.
